Vattenfall to expand UK wind presence
Vattenfall is set to buy one of the UK's biggest proposed offshore wind farms, in the latest step in its aggressive push into the British wind energy market.
In September, Vattenfall announced it would buy Eclipse Energy, a developer with a portfolio of six wind projects under development with a projected capacity of about 200MW, for £51.5m. Last month, the company bought Amec Wind Energy, with a capacity of nearly 60MW, for £127m.
Climate Change Capital, a boutique investment bank specialising in carbon cutting projects has advised Vattenfall on its deals.
